i believe that would be simply berouli's principal causeing the suction. the venturi is whats in your carbeurator, and it is simply a constriction in the intake tract like this: )( that speeds up the air lowering the pressure (berouli's principal), therefore bringing the gas from the bowl in to equalize the pressure. since the exhaust gas is already flowing, you are simply employing berouli's principal, as no venturi is actually used.
the terms venturi and bernouli are often interchanged, so i don't not know whether venturi refers to the constriction, or to the act of equalizing the pressure (pulling a substance from a resivoir using the flow of a fluid) but i know that bernoulis principal simply states that as a fluid increases in speed, it must decrease in pressure to maintain a constant amount of energy along the flow.....so maybe this is venturi....
